Screen Idlers!

How often have you heard it told:

It’s a challenge – growing old?

We take our lives for granted, then

Health issues crowd in– bye, bye zen!

 

Long-term friends still keep in touch:

So, WhatsApp /Email – thanks so much!

But nothing beats a face-to-face

Though health concerns slow down life’s race …

 

I marvel how we’ve lived so far

Born under post-war lucky star

With full employment, family joys

Before A.I. our peace destroys!

 

We savour memories of youth

When life seemed simpler, less uncouth

When photographs were ours alone

And no one tried to scam our phone.

 

But life is NOW and burn-out reigns

Stupid adverts jerk our chains

Via flickering small screens of blue:

Has “1984” come true?
